Understanding Lymphedema: A Chronic Condition
Millions of Americans live with lymphedema, a condition characterized by chronic swelling. It occurs when the lymphatic system is damaged or blocked, preventing proper fluid drainage. This leads to persistent swelling, often in the arms or legs, and can significantly impact daily life.
What is Lymphedema?
Does Ketoprofen Help Lymphedema? Expert Analysis Lymphedema is classified into two main types: primary and secondary. Primary lymphedema is rare and often hereditary, while secondary lymphedema is more common and results from external factors. These include surgery, radiation, or infections that damage the lymph nodes or vessels.
Causes and Risk Factors
One of the leading causes of secondary lymphedema is breast cancer treatment. Approximately 30% of breast cancer patients develop lymphedema after surgery or radiation. Other risk factors include obesity, aging, and genetic predisposition. These factors can further strain the lymphatic system, increasing the likelihood of swelling.

The Role of Inflammation in Lymphedema
Chronic inflammation is a key factor in worsening lymphatic system dysfunction. When inflammation persists, it disrupts the body’s ability to repair damaged lymphatic vessels. This leads to impaired fluid drainage and chronic swelling, which are hallmarks of lymphedema.
How Inflammation Affects Lymphatic Function
Inflammation interferes with the repair of lymphatic vessels, making it harder for the system to function properly. Stanford researchers identified leukotriene B4 (LTB4) as a key inflammatory molecule driving this pathology. LTB4 contributes to tissue inflammation, impairing drainage and worsening symptoms. Does Ketoprofen Help Lymphedema? Expert Analysis
Chronic inflammation also leads to fibrosis and adipose deposition. These changes further strain the lymphatic system, creating a cycle of damage and dysfunction. Understanding these mechanisms is crucial for developing effective treatments.

What is Ketoprofen?
Ketoprofen, a widely used NSAID, has shown potential in addressing complex inflammatory conditions. Classified as a nonsteroidal anti-inflammatory drug, it works by inhibiting cyclooxygenase (COX) enzymes. This action reduces the production of prostaglandins and leukotriene B4 (LTB4), key drivers of inflammation.
Mechanism of Action
Ketoprofen’s dual inhibition of COX-1 and COX-2 enzymes makes it effective in reducing pain and swelling. By suppressing LTB4, it also targets inflammation at a molecular level. This dual action sets it apart from other NSAIDs like ibuprofen, which primarily focus on COX inhibition.

Overview of Clinical Trials
Stanford conducted two pivotal trials to evaluate the efficacy of an anti-inflammatory treatment. The first was a 21-patient open-label study, which demonstrated a 73% reduction in skin thickness. The second trial involved 34 participants in a placebo-controlled format, confirming the treatment’s effectiveness. Both studies spanned four months and utilized biopsy-based outcomes to measure progress.
Key Findings from Research
Patients reported significant improvements in skin texture and mobility. The trials also noted a reduction in granulocyte colony-stimulating factor (G-CSF) levels, a marker of inflammation. These results suggest that targeting inflammation can lead to measurable improvements in lymphatic function.

Potential Side Effects of Ketoprofen
While innovative treatments offer new hope, understanding potential side effects is crucial for patient safety. Like all medications, this NSAID carries risks that patients and healthcare providers must consider. Balancing benefits and risks ensures the best outcomes for those managing chronic conditions.
Gastrointestinal Concerns
One of the most common side effects is gastrointestinal discomfort. In clinical trials, 15% of participants reported mild issues such as stomach pain or nausea. These symptoms are typical of NSAIDs, which can irritate the stomach lining and increase the risk of ulcers.
To mitigate these risks, proton pump inhibitors were co-administered in some trials. This approach helps protect the stomach lining and reduces discomfort. Patients with a history of ulcers or gastrointestinal issues should discuss preventive measures with their healthcare provider.
Cardiovascular Risks
While no cardiovascular events were recorded in trials, long-term use of NSAIDs can pose risks. Hypertension and increased heart strain are potential concerns, especially for patients with pre-existing conditions. Regular monitoring is recommended for those using this medication over extended periods.
